Mark Manson's Transition from Author to YouTuber
Mark Manson, a bestselling author, shares his experience transitioning from being an author to a YouTuber. He explains that after feeling burnt out from writing about personal development topics for many years, he realized he needed a change. He experimented with different ideas, including a novel and screenplay writing, but ultimately found himself drawn to YouTube. He saw an opportunity to bring more mature and emotionally challenging content to the platform, leveraging his years of experience in personal growth. He describes the excitement and challenge of creating videos that showcase real-life situations and the emotional journey of overcoming fears. Despite the initial fear of being canceled and some rejection from viewers, he finds the process fun and rewarding.
Mark Manson's Journey of Rest and Recovery
In the podcast, Mark Manson discusses the importance of rest and recovery. He shares his personal experience of taking a six-month break from work and the struggles he faced during that time. Initially, he felt self-judgment and anxiety about not working and feared that he would be forgotten by his audience. However, as he gave himself permission to take time off, he recognized the freedom it brought him and allowed him to view work as something fun and interesting again. He shares that the break helped him let go of expectations and pressure, leading to a renewed sense of enjoyment and enthusiasm for his creative endeavors.
Mark Manson's Approach to Change and Transition
Mark Manson explores the theme of change and transition in his conversation. He emphasizes the principle of identity avoidance, which states that people will resist anything that threatens their identity, even if it's a positive change. He reflects on his own journey of change, particularly shifting from being an author to a YouTuber. Rather than feeling grief for shedding his old identity, he finds relief in recognizing that his identity as a creative person is not tied to a specific medium. He encourages embracing a broad definition of oneself and not being limited by labels or expectations. Embracing change, he believes, requires finding fun and joy in the creative process and being true to oneself.
Advice for Embracing the Journey of Book Launch
Mark Manson provides advice for the upcoming book launch. He suggests keeping it fun and enjoyable, particularly focusing on celebrating the journey and the fans who have followed and supported the author throughout the years. He emphasizes that the quality of the book itself will ultimately drive sales, regardless of promotional efforts. He advises focusing on the meaningfulness of the book and the story it tells instead of seeking validation from external sources. By honoring this chapter of life and the story captured in the pages, the author can navigate the book launch process with more authenticity and satisfaction.
